VehicleHvacService
The VehicleHvacService interface provides access to state information coming from the vehicle Heating Ventilation and Air Conditioning (HVAC) controls via properties and exposes methods to update the values of the HVAC controls.
Not all vehicles have all the HVAC functionality onboard and specific functionality can be temporarily unavailable. To reflect this the properties can have different states. These states are described by the following scenarios:
Steering wheel heater is not supported by the vehicle.
Steering wheel heater is supported by the vehicle, but unavailable.
Steering wheel heater is supported by the vehicle and set to a specific heat level.
The fan speed level is supported by the vehicle, but unsupported for seat area row 3 right.
The fan speed level is supported by the vehicle, but unavailable for seat area row 3 right.
The fan speed level is supported by the vehicle and for seat area row 3 right set to a specific speed level.
Types
Properties
Functions
Sets the "auto" mode of the air conditioner for a specific zone.
Sets the "eco" mode of the air conditioner for a specific zone.
Sets the "max defrost" mode of the air conditioner for a specific zone.
Sets the "max" mode of the air conditioner for a specific zone.
Sets the power of the air conditioner for a specific zone.
Sets the air recirculation for a specific zone.
Sets the cabin target temperature for a specific zone.
Sets the fan direction for a specific zone.
Sets the fan speed level for a specific zone.
Sets the power state for a specific zone.
Sets the seat heater level for a specific zone.
Sets the steering wheel heater level.
Sets the temperature synchronization for a specific zone.
Sets the defroster for a specific zone.